About

The St. Louis Science Center and surrounding Forest Park area includes EV charging stations, making it a convenient stop for families visiting the Science Center with electric vehicles. The smart strategy is to plug in on arrival and let the car charge during your museum visit — a typical Science Center visit runs 3–5 hours, which is ample time for a meaningful Level 2 charge.

EV charging availability at cultural destinations is increasingly important for families who've transitioned to electric vehicles. The Science Center's location in Forest Park, one of St. Louis's primary family destination areas, makes it a useful anchor point for EV-driving visitors planning a full day in the park.

Practical notes: check the ChargePoint or PlugShare app before arriving to confirm current charger availability and pricing. Charger availability can vary, and real-time apps give you the most accurate picture. Level 2 charging is typical at this type of installation; DC fast charging may or may not be available depending on the specific station configuration.

For families planning a full Forest Park day (Science Center + Zoo + playground), charging at the Science Center during your morning visit means arriving at the Zoo with a full battery in the afternoon. The free general admission to the Science Center means your only cost is the charging session itself.
